WebFeb 15, 2024 · The fact that there are many homophones is probably one of the reasons that kanji still exist in Japanese. Without kanji and only hiragana, we would have that 糖衣、東夷、当為、等位、… would all be とうい. Hepburn romanization goes even further, and also conflates とうい (e.g. 糖衣、東夷、当為、等位、…) and とおい (e.g. 遠い) to tōi. WebMar 6, 2013 · The word Japan in Japanese kanji is 日本. This actually looks identical to how it’s written in Chinese as well. As you might have guessed, these two kanji are pronounced ni and hon. Hiragana ( 平仮名, ひらがな, Japanese pronunciation: [çiɾaɡaꜜna]) [note 1] is a Japanese syllabary, part of the Japanese writing system, along with katakana as well as kanji .
